Problems solved by technology

[0004] Among them, the method based on lateral acceleration may cause misjudgment of events due to vehicle lane changes, lane departures, "S" curves, and slope turning events similar to sharp turns.
The method based on the direct integration of the gyroscope, although it can roughly judge the attitude of the vehicle, it cannot accurately grasp the information such as the turning angle of the vehicle and the change of the attitude angle, and it is even more difficult to know the aggressiveness of the turning of the vehicle.
Especially in the process of turning on a slope, the movement process of the vehicle is not only manifested as a change in azimuth angle, but also a change in the horizontal attitude angle (pitch angle, roll angle). The method of direct integration using the gyroscope is prone to misjudgment

[0082] In the prior art, a single method is generally used to obtain the state of the vehicle, for example, obtaining the position and speed of the vehicle through GPS, and obtaining navigation parameters using MEMS inertial sensors. The accuracy of these methods is not very high, and they are greatly affected by environmental factors, and errors are prone to occur. Abstract

The invention discloses a navigation parameter acquisition method, system and device. The method comprises the following steps: initializing navigation parameters of a target vehicle by combining an inertial sensor and GPS; performing strapdown resolving on first operation data of the inertial sensor and updating current navigation parameters. The invention further discloses a vehicle sharp turn judgment method, system and device. The method comprises the following steps: acquiring real-time lateral acceleration of the target vehicle; acquiring navigation parameters of the target vehicle withthe navigation parameter acquisition method when the real-time lateral acceleration exceeds the lateral acceleration threshold value, and calculating an azimuth change angle and an attitude change angle; acquiring real-time vehicle speed when the azimuth change angle exceeds the azimuth change angle threshold and the attitude change angle does not exceed the attitude change angle threshold; judging whether the real-time vehicle speed exceeds a vehicle speed threshold; if yes, determining that the target vehicle turns sharply. Speed judgment and judgment accuracy are both taken into consideration, and finally, a judgment result about whether the target vehicle turns sharply can be obtained quickly and accurately.
